Permission to Fear: How Brooke Shaden Became a Fine Art Photographer

Creative Live

Fear is often seen as a weakness to be overcome — but for fine art photographer Brooke Shaden, fear became a launching point to a creative career. In her first year, she paid for 14 gallery shows and never made her initial investment back on any of them. Photo by Brooke Shaden.
